  1. An on-chip three-level boost converter for energy harvesting application

    The first on-chip three-level boost converter with 0.28 mm2 die size is implemented using 65 nm CMOS technology. Leveraging the advantages of hybrid switched capacitor converters, the converter manages to provide a maximum output voltage of 4.5 V with the available 2.5 V devices in this technology. …
